Output 33c40d5e328e7e897217ddb01163ff467e9af4fb847e863a0ffc0fdcc9fcff12:1

value
12590152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f6da73d9020f1618d7b82358b3c293e35a2f9c1 OP_EQUAL
address
3DJo6kSuNrjwp7bzB7ceLG5ftMoX5LLbmP
transaction
33c40d5e328e7e897217ddb01163ff467e9af4fb847e863a0ffc0fdcc9fcff12
spent
true